Paragon Virtual kindly visited us to showcase the Bakers’ Brewery in their super-cool 3-D video/picture/tour technology. Bakers’ Brewery is an unusual location. Once upon a time our building housed a Village Inn and it is still quite evident. We refurbished the building and now have an American-Modern pub. We are inspired by the natural elements in an industrial yet comfortable setting. There is a storm cloud over the bar, ancient white oak at the bar, green granite bar and blue sky walls and dusk blue ceiling.

More than anything, we wanted an approachable brewpub where people can come enjoy our brews and home cooking. Try out the new 3-D tour! It’s perfect for people who are contemplating booking our Brewers’ corner for an event. The Brewers’ corner comfortably sits between 25 and 30 people and we have different dining options for different sized parties.

Summit County Collaboration #2

This year, the Bakers’ Brewery was lucky enough to participate again in the Summit County-wide collaboration brew. This year the inspiration of six brewmasters led us to brew a Barleywine at the Backcountry brewery. The resulting “Safety Meeting” is a delicious testament to Summit’s six great breweries.  The “Safety Meeting” was featured this past weekend at the Brewer Rock for Rescue event in Silverthorne at the Pavilion.
